Legal Representative vs. Lawyer : What’s Distinction & Whom Do A Client?

Many people use the terms attorney and attorney interchangeably, but there's a slight variation. A legal professional is someone who has graduated from a law faculty and has obtained a jurisprudence certificate. However, not every lawyer is an counsel . To become an counselor , a legal professional must also succeed in the bar examination and be registered to provide get more info law in a specific location. Essentially, all attorneys are legal professionals , but not all jurists are legal representatives.

Consequently, who shall you engage ? If you require legal counsel or representation, you need an attorney - someone licensed to represent in court and provide full legal support. Here’s a quick recap :

  • Lawyer : An individual who has a law degree.
  • Legal Representative: A jurist who is licensed to provide law.
